M744 SRE is a 1994 Yamaha TZR125 in White with a 124c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70%.
Across all 1994 Yamaha TZR125 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.5% with a typical mileage of 22,070 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Yamaha TZR125 fails its MOT is reflector on motorcycle missing, accounting for 265 recorded failures. If you're considering buying M744 SRE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Yamaha TZR125 typ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 32 years old, this Yamaha TZR125 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
